Derek Jacobi as Robunce Barnatty in This Is Jinsy - new picture
Sir Derek Jacobi has appeared in new photos from This Is Jinsy.

The Last Tango in Halifax and Vicious actor will appear in the seventh episode of the second series of the comedy.

He will play Robunce Barnatty in the Sky Atlantic show, who is the eldest resident of Jinsy island.

This Is Jinsy returns on Wednesday, January 8 with a double bill at 10pm.

The series was created by Chris Bran and Justin Chubb and directed by Matt Lipsey. It follows Arbiter Maven (Chubb) and Sporall (Bran), the residents of an extraordinary island.

The details of the guest appearances are as follows:

Episode 1: Stephen Fry as Dr Bevelspepp, who uses his encyclopaedic knowledge of Jinsy to help save the island from an invasion of rampaging hair

Episode 2: Ben Miller as the Chief Accountant of Jinsy as well as his daughter Berpetta, a drunk, hefty, buck-toothed accountant

Stephen Fry, Rob Brydon, Olivia Colman for new 'This Is Jinsy' series
Stephen Fry and Rob Brydon are among the stars who will feature in the second series of This Is Jinsy.

The comedy series from Chris Bran and Justin Chubb will return to Sky Atlantic in January 2014.

Olivia Colman, Sir Derek Jacobi and Stephen Mangan will also make guest appearances in the show.

This Is Jinsy centres around Arbiter Maven (Chubb) and Sporall (Bran) as they attempt to handle the residents of a unique island, based on the writers' experiences of living in Guernsey.

Consisting of eight episodes, the new series will see Stephen Fry portray Dr Bevelspepp, who uses his encyclopaedic knowledge of Jinsy to help save the island from an attack.

Katy Brand, Dame Eileen Atkins, Phil Davis, KT Tunstall and Greg Davies will also guest star throughout the series.

Among the returning stars are Alice Lowe as Soosan Noop, Janine Duvitski as Mrs Goadion and Geoff McGivern as Trince.

'This Is Jinsy' lands second season on Sky Atlantic in 2013
This Is Jinsy (2010)
Surreal comedy This Is Jinsy has been granted a second series by Sky Atlantic. Creators Chris Bran and Justin Chubb won critical acclaim for their show earlier this year. It was originally dropped by BBC Three after only a pilot aired. Sky's head of comedy Lucy Lumsden said: "I can't wait to travel back to the wonderful island of Jinsy for another series of insanely brilliant comedy. Chris and Justin's creation is the perfect fit for Sky Atlantic HD and its wealth of unique story-telling." This is Jinsy: Costume Insanity
Recently underway on Sky Atlantic, This is Jinsy is one of those comedy shows set in a surreal world of madness that you either get or you don’t. Frequently hilarious and always interesting, from a costume point of view this is retro fancy dress, deliberately mismatched and performance orientated. Yet everything in Jinsy makes sense within its own world.

The island of Jinsy is populated (791 residents) by all manner of weird and wonderful people. The locale has been likened to The Wicker Man’s Summerisle but is spiritually closer to the Village from Patrick McGoohan’s sixties TV series, The Prisoner. Everyone in Jinsy seems trapped there but somehow content. Episode one entitled ‘The Wedding Lottery’ introduces a lot of faces very quickly. All the inhabitants are broadly drawn, however, so relatively easy to fathom.

David Tennant, Catherine Tate join 'This Is Jinsy'
David Tennant
David Tennant, Catherine Tate and Jennifer Saunders have signed up to appear in Sky Atlantic's new comedy This Is Jinsy. The eight-part series stars newcomers Chris Bran and Justin Chubb as Arbiter Maven and Operative Sporall, who watch over the residents of the fictional island of Jinsy. Sky has now confirmed that Tennant, Tate and Saunders have all agreed to guest roles in the show. They will be joined by Harry Hill, Jane Horrocks, Simon Callow, Kevin Eldon, Peter Serafinowicz and Brian Murphy, who have also signed up to appear in the series. Tennant will play a corrupt wedding planner called Mr Slightlyman in the first episode, while Hill will appear as Joon Boolay, who delivers punishments from a television studio.
